Autism Camp LeadThe Autism Project, a Lifespan PartnerThe Autism Project, is hiring Camp Leads for Camp WANNAGOAGAIN! Camp Leads provide leadership and supervision of support staff and campers, ensure health, safety and general wellbeing of campers, and implement & maintain a highly structured, safe, appropriate, fun-filled program.The Autism Project’s Camp WANNAGOAGAIN provides a safe, supported, and fun camp experience for children, teens, and young adults with ASD & related social-emotional or communication challenges. Our camp program is designed to provide opportunities for real-life experiences, an environment to learn new leisure skills, and the chance to meet new friends in a structured environment with experienced staff.
